> Michael Vanier <mvanier@bbb.caltech.edu> writes:
>
> > I use "misc 10x20" font normally, with dark green background, white
> > foreground and khaki cursor colors (and without a blinking cursor). I set
> > these in my .Xresources file.
>
> Could you please send me the section concerning Emacs from your
> .Xresources?
Just this:
emacs*pointerColor: khaki
emacs*cursorColor: khaki
emacs*background: #286040
emacs*foreground: #c8c8c8
emacs*geometry: =85x33+0+0
emacs*font: 10x20
So the background is not *exactly* dark green, but it's close.
>
> > Under these circumstances I never get a cursor in emacs 21.1. If I
> > remove all references to .emacs from my .Xresources, I get a cursor
> > on the default font only.
> >
> > Oddly, I also get a disappearing cursor in emacs 20.7, but under different
> > circumstances. In that program, if I start the program with `-q' and
> > remove all references to emacs in my .Xresources file, the default font
> > causes the cursor to disappear. Using any other "misc" font causes the
> > cursor to reappear, and it stays there even if you switch back to the
> > default font. When I set my preferences in the .Xresources file I always
> > get a cursor in 20.7.
> >
> > Is it a bad idea to use the .Xresources file to set emacs options?
>
> Apparently yes, but it shouldn't be :-).
